Problem
Current vehicle-to-vehicle communication systems lack robust association methods for physical and virtual identities, making them susceptible to false information from third parties, especially when multiple vehicles have similar physical characteristics and visible light channels are intercepted.
Innovation Solution
Implementing a challenge-response protocol using both wireless and visible light communication channels, synchronized with a shared timeline, to verify the association of physical and virtual identities, with encryption methods such as session key or public key encryption to secure the communication.

2Loss of information
If perception sensors detect multiple target vehicles, then comprehensive situational awareness is achieved, but it becomes difficult to verify which virtual identity corresponds to the correct physical identity
Solution Approach 1:
The patent implements a challenge-response protocol where the ego vehicle sends a challenge to a target vehicle through the wireless channel, and the target vehicle responds through the visible light channel. This feedback mechanism allows the ego vehicle to verify that the visible light communication indeed originates from the detected physical vehicle, thereby ensuring accurate identity association among multiple detected vehicles.
Solution Approach 2:
The challenge-response protocol acts as an intermediary verification mechanism between the physical vehicle detection and virtual identity assignment. By introducing this verification step, the system can reliably associate virtual identities with physical vehicles even when multiple vehicles are detected, resolving the identity association ambiguity.

A system within an ego vehicle for robust association of a physical identity and a virtual identity of a target vehicle includes a data processor, including a wireless communication module and a visible light communication module, positioned within an ego vehicle, and a plurality of perception sensors, positioned within the ego vehicle and adapted to collect data related to a physical identity of the target vehicle and to communicate the data related to the physical identity of the target vehicle to the data processor via a communication bus, the data processor within the ego vehicle adapted to receive, via a wireless communication channel, data related to a virtual identity of the target vehicle, associate the physical identity of the target vehicle with the virtual identity of the target vehicle, and initiate, via the wireless communication channel and a visible light communication channel, a challenge-response protocol between the ego vehicle and the target vehicle.
